For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public middle schools serving 866 students in Grand Ledge 51爆料s. This district's average middle testing ranking is 9/10, which is in the top 20% of public middle schools in Michigan.
Public Middle Schools in Grand Ledge 51爆料s have an average math proficiency score of 45% (versus the Michigan public middle school average of 31%), and reading proficiency score of 59% (versus the 44%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 24%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Michigan public middle school average of 42% (majority Black).

District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$14,575 in this school district is less than the state median of $18,510. The school district revenue/student has grown by 8%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$18,906 is higher than the state median of $17,693. The school district spending/student has grown by 47% over four school years.
